Navigating the Path to Success: Selecting the Right Medical Device Testing Laboratory

In the intricate world of medical device development, ensuring the safety and efficacy of your product is of paramount importance. This is where medical device testing comes into play, acting as a crucial checkpoint in the journey to market success.

However, with a plethora of testing laboratories vying for your attention, choosing the right partner can be a daunting task. To help you make an informed decision, we’ve compiled a comprehensive guide to help you navigate the selection process effectively.

  1. Expertise and Experience: The Foundation of Trust

When entrusting your medical device to a testing laboratory, experience and expertise are non-negotiable factors. Look for a laboratory with a proven track record of successfully testing devices similar to yours. This expertise will ensure that your product receives the specialized attention it deserves.

  1. Certification and accreditation: The Gold Standard of Quality

Accreditation is a hallmark of a laboratory’s commitment to quality and adherence to international standards. Opt for a laboratory that holds ISO 17025 accreditation, the globally recognized standard for testing laboratories. This accreditation guarantees that the laboratory adheres to stringent quality management systems and follows Good Laboratory Practice (GLP) guidelines, ensuring the integrity and reliability of test results.

  1. Capabilities: Matching Your Needs with Expertise

Ensure that the laboratory possesses the necessary equipment, facilities, and expertise to cater to your specific testing requirements. This includes assessing their capabilities in conducting biocompatibility testing, toxicology testing, and other relevant tests specific to your medical device.
